# Runbook: Hunting leaked file descriptors in Quillgate

When the `fd_open` gauge climbs steadily between deploys, suspect a leak rather than load. First confirm on a single pod: exec in and count entries under `/proc/1/fd`, noting how many are sockets in CLOSE_WAIT versus regular files. Capture two snapshots ten minutes apart before restarting anything — we need the delta for the postmortem. Reproduce locally with the Marbury load harness, which requires the service running with the following configuration values.

settings of yagep-bajog:
[istdor]
port = 4000
region = south-2
host = istdor.qorvelcorp.internal
timeout_ms = 5000
retries = 5

Q: Why do Nimbrel sessions drop every 14 minutes?

A: Known bug in the token-refresh path. The refresh call races the expiry check, so a token can expire mid-request. Fix is in review: widen the grace window and serialize refreshes per session. Reviewers: check branch fix/refresh-race and the new mutex in TokenMinter. To reproduce locally you must unseal the test keystore, which requires the recovery passphrase below.

unlock words, yawig-kagef: gordor-holvan-ulaael-pramir-ulaiel-tamdor

Capacity note for the Gallerist audio-guide backend. Peak load occurs in the first hour after the Hollowmere Museum opens, when roughly 70% of daily tour starts happen. Audio segments are pre-cached per wing; cache sizing, not CPU, is the binding constraint. If adding a wing, resize the cache pool before launch day. The constants governing pool and prefetch behavior are the following.

limits module of tafop-hahop:
WEIGHTS = {
    "julmir": 223,
    "belox": 987,
    "lamion": 470,
    "pelath": 609,
    "fraok": 1010,
    "eliion": 343,
    "drudor": 342,
}